Overview Crosteen 10mg Tablet

Lipitor 10mg tablets are statin medications that lower cholesterol, mitigating the risk of cardiovascular events. High cholesterol, a fatty substance accumulating in blood vessels, causes narrowing and potentially heart attacks or strokes. Widely prescribed and generally safe for long-term use under medical supervision, Lipitor 10mg can be taken with or without food, consistently at the same time daily. While high cholesterol is often asymptomatic, discontinuation increases cardiovascular risk. Regular cholesterol monitoring is crucial. Treatment includes this medication, alongside a balanced diet, exercise, smoking cessation, moderate alcohol consumption, and weight management. Maintain a normal diet, limiting high-fat foods. Common, usually transient, side effects include constipation, gas, indigestion, and stomach pain. Persistent symptoms, jaundice, or recurring muscle aches warrant medical attention. Contraindicated in liver disease, pregnancy, and breastfeeding due to potential fetal harm. Diabetics should monitor blood sugar levels, as increases may occur. Liver function tests may be conducted before and during treatment.

How Crosteen 10mg Tablet works:

Lipitor 10mg tablets, a statin drug, inhibit HMG-CoA reductase, a crucial enzyme in cholesterol synthesis. This action reduces levels of LDL cholesterol ("bad" cholesterol) and triglycerides while increasing HDL cholesterol ("good" cholesterol).

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holCAUTION

Exercise caution when combining Crosteen 10mg tablets with alcohol. Seek medical advice before doing so.

PregnancyPregnancyUNSAFE

Using Crosteen 10mg tablets during pregnancy is strongly contraindicated. Pregnant women should consult their physician; research in animals and pregnant humans indicates considerable risk of harm to the fetus.

Breast feedingBreast feedingUNSAFE

Lactation and Crosteen 10mg tablets are incompatible. Evidence indicates potential infant toxicity from this medication.

DrivingDrivingSAFE

Driving ability is typically unaffected by Crosteen 10mg Tablets.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Crosteen 10mg tablets can be used safely by individuals with kidney disorders; no dosage modification is necessary. Nevertheless, disclosure of any pre-existing kidney condition to your physician is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Individuals with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Crosteen 10mg tablets;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ised. Crosteen 10mg tablets are contraindicated in patients experiencing severe or active liver disease.

What if you forget to take Crosteen 10mg Tablet :

Should you forget a Crosteen 10mg Tablet dose,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king two doses within a 12-hour period.

FAQs on Crosteen 10mg Tablet

Your blood contains cholesterol, a type of fat. Total cholesterol reflects the combined levels of LDL and HDL cholesterol. LDL, or "bad" cholesterol, can accumulate in blood vessel walls, reducing or blocking blood flow to vital organs, potentially leading to heart disease and stroke. HDL, or "good" cholesterol, helps prevent this buildup. High triglyceride levels also pose health risks.
Muscle problems, including pain, tenderness, weakness, and fatigue, are potential side effects of Crosteen 10mg Tablet due to reduced oxygen flow to muscles. This muscle soreness can be severe enough to disrupt daily life. Consult your doctor to discuss preventative measures and management of this side effect.
Crosteen 10mg, a statin, reduces high blood lipid levels (cholesterol and triglycerides) when diet and lifestyle changes prove insufficient. It also lowers the risk of heart disease, even with normal cholesterol, but requires adherence to a cholesterol-lowering diet.
Crosteen 10mg tablets are for adults and children 10 years and older whose cholesterol remains high despite diet and exercise. This medication is not suitable for children under 10.
Crosteen 10mg tablets don't thin the blood; they lower cholesterol. This medication reduces cholesterol production, preventing artery-clogging buildup and the resulting restricted blood flow. Lowering cholesterol and triglycerides helps prevent strokes and heart attacks.
For individuals at high risk of type 2 diabetes, Crosteen 10mg Tablet may modestly increase this risk due to its potential for slight blood sugar elevation. If you already have type 2 diabetes, your doctor might recommend more frequent blood sugar monitoring during the initial months of treatment. Report any difficulty managing your blood sugar levels to your physician.
Crosteen 10mg Tablets may be needed for life, or as directed by your doctor. Continued cholesterol benefit requires consistent use. Stopping treatment without a doctor's alternative may lead to increased cholesterol levels. When taken as prescribed, it's generally safe and has minimal side effects.
Crosteen 10mg Tablets are not known to cause weight loss; in fact, weight gain is a reported, albeit uncommon, side effect. Consult your doctor if you lose weight while using this medication.
Don't discontinue Crosteen 10mg Tablet without your doctor's advice. If you experience side effects, contact your doctor; they can adjust your dosage or prescribe an alternative medication.
Avoid alcohol while taking Crosteen 10mg tablets. Combining alcohol with this medication raises your risk of liver damage, significantly increases triglyceride levels, and may worsen side effects like muscle pain, weakness, and tenderness. Individuals with pre-existing liver conditions should consult their doctor before using Crosteen 10mg tablets and abstain from alcohol during treatment for optimal results.
Rarely, Crosteen 10mg Tablet may cause memory loss, typically mild and resolving within three weeks of stopping treatment. This side effect can emerge anytime from one day to several years after starting the medication. Consult your doctor if you experience memory problems, as other causes are possible.
Take one Crosteen 10mg tablet daily, at the same time each day, with or without food. Morning, evening, or anytime is suitable.
Crosteen 10mg Tablets can cause fatigue, possibly by reducing muscle energy. While the precise mechanism is unclear and requires further study, tiredness often follows physical activity. Widespread fatigue is more common in individuals with heart or liver conditions. Muscle damage, another side effect of Crosteen 10mg Tablets, may exacerbate this fatigue. Consult your doctor if you experience tiredness while using this medication.
Crosteen 10mg Tablet may cause nausea, indigestion, constipation, gas, diarrhea, headache, and musculoskeletal pain. Other possible side effects include nosebleeds, sore throat, and upper respiratory symptoms like runny or stuffy nose, and sneezing.
